Overview
The ST72F521R9T3 is an 8-bit microcontroller from STMicroelectronics, designed for a wide range of applications requiring robust performance and versatile peripheral sets. This microcontroller is part of the ST7 family and is known for its high-density flash memory and extensive set of on-chip peripherals. It is particularly suited for industrial control, automotive, and consumer electronics due to its reliability and low power consumption.
Key Specifications
Specification | Details |
---|---|
Core Processor | ST7 |
Core Size | 8-bit |
Speed | Up to 8 MHz |
Program Memory Size | 60 KBytes Flash |
RAM Size | 2 KBytes |
Operating Voltage | 3.8V to 5.5V |
Temperature Range | -40°C to +125°C |
Package | TQFP80 14x14, TQFP64 14x14, TQFP64 10x10 |
Number of I/O Ports | Up to 64 I/O Ports |
Communications Interfaces | SPI, SCI, I2C, CAN (2.0B Passive) |
Analog Peripherals | 10-bit ADC with 16 input ports |
Key Features
- High-Density Flash Memory: 60 KBytes of dual voltage High Density Flash (HDFlash) with read-out protection capability and In-Application Programming (IAP) and In-Circuit Programming (ICP) support.
- Low Power Modes: Four power saving modes including Halt, Active-Halt, Wait, and Slow modes to optimize power consumption.
- Interrupt Management: Nested interrupt controller with 14 interrupt vectors plus TRAP and RESET, and 15 external interrupt lines.
- Timers and Clock Management: Main Clock Controller with real-time base, beep, and clock-out capabilities, along with multiple timers including 16-bit timers and an 8-bit PWM Auto-Reload timer.
- Communications Interfaces: SPI, SCI, I2C (SMbus V1.1 compliant), and CAN (2.0B Passive) interfaces for versatile communication options.
- Analog Peripherals: 10-bit ADC with 16 robust input ports.
- I/O Ports: Up to 64 I/O ports with 48 multifunctional bidirectional I/O lines and 34 alternate function lines.
Applications
The ST72F521R9T3 microcontroller is suitable for a variety of applications, including:
- Industrial Control: Automation, motor control, and industrial automation systems.
- Automotive Systems: Vehicle control units, dashboard instruments, and other automotive electronics.
- Consumer Electronics: Home appliances, remote controls, and other consumer devices requiring robust and efficient microcontrollers.
- Medical Devices: Although not authorized for life support devices without express approval, it can be used in other medical equipment requiring reliable microcontrollers.
Q & A
- What is the core processor of the ST72F521R9T3 microcontroller?
The core processor is the ST7, an 8-bit microcontroller core. - What is the maximum speed of the ST72F521R9T3?
The maximum speed is up to 8 MHz. - How much program memory does the ST72F521R9T3 have?
The ST72F521R9T3 has 60 KBytes of Flash memory. - What are the power saving modes available in the ST72F521R9T3?
The available power saving modes are Halt, Active-Halt, Wait, and Slow modes. - Does the ST72F521R9T3 support In-Application Programming (IAP)?
Yes, it supports both In-Application Programming (IAP) and In-Circuit Programming (ICP). - What types of communication interfaces are available on the ST72F521R9T3?
The available communication interfaces include SPI, SCI, I2C (SMbus V1.1 compliant), and CAN (2.0B Passive). - How many I/O ports does the ST72F521R9T3 have?
The ST72F521R9T3 has up to 64 I/O ports. - What is the operating voltage range of the ST72F521R9T3?
The operating voltage range is from 3.8V to 5.5V. - What is the temperature range for the ST72F521R9T3?
The temperature range is from -40°C to +125°C. - Is the ST72F521R9T3 authorized for use in life support devices?
No, it is not authorized for use in life support devices without express written approval from STMicroelectronics.